Moderation

What is moderation?

the governance mechanisms that structure participation in a community to facilitate cooperation and prevent abuse. (Grimmelmann 2015, p. 47)

[it helps] communities walk the tightrope between the chaos of too much freedom and the sterility of too much control (Grimmelmann 2015, p. 42)

Grammar

  • Techniques (Verbs)
    • excluding (gatekeeper)
    • pricing (membership fee)
    • organizing
      • deletion, editing, annotation, synthesis, filtering, and formatting
    • norm-setting
  • Distinctions (Adverbs)
    • automatically/manually
    • transparently/secretly
    • ex ante (deterrence) / ex post (punished)
    • central/distributed
  • Community Characteristics (Adjectives)
    • infrastructure capacity
    • community size
    • identity / anonymity
